A Broad Overview of Vardenafil

Vardenafil, commercially known by its brand name Levitra among others, is a PDE5 inhibitor - a class of drugs primarily intended to treat erectile dysfunction. By enhancing the natural mechanism that prompts penile erection during sexual stimulation, it allows those struggling with ED to regain sexual function.

The Underlying Principle: PDE5 Inhibition

The role of ph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5) inhibitors such as Vardenafil is to suppress the activity of the PDE5 enzyme. This action subsequently affects cGMP - a molecule responsible for instigating and maintaining an erection. The PDE5 enzyme would typically degrade cGMP; thus, by inhibiting this action, Vardenafil prolongs the presence of cGMP in the blood, prolonging an erection.

From Discovery to Application

Vardenafil marked its inception in the laboratories of pharmaceutical giant Bayer AG. After numerous clinical trials and investigations, it was approved by the FDA in August 2003. Its entry revolutionized the ED treatment landscape, offering a remarkable alternative to existing treatment options. Its high bioavailability and negligible food interactions gave it an edge over contemporaries.

Comparative Advantages

Modern medical research has reflected on the advantages of Vardenafil over its counterparts. Relative to similar drugs like Sildenafil (Viagra), Vardenafil showcases a higher selectivity for PDE5 and an improved side-effect profile. As such, lesser visual disturbances noted with its usage add to its appeal.

Considerations and Contraindications

Like any medication, Vardenafil is not without its limitations and carries several contraindications, including individuals with significant cardiovascular disease or those on nitrates. It is ultimately critical for healthcare providers to assess individual risk before its prescription.
